The Masterclass Certificate in Feminist Disability Studies prepares students for exciting roles in a growing field. With a focus on accessibility, human rights, and intersectional feminism, graduates can expect to make a difference in various industries. Here's a look at some of the top job opportunities and their respective market trends: 1. **Accessibility Specialist**: These professionals ensure that products, facilities, and services are accessible to people with disabilities. The demand for accessibility specialists is on the rise due to increased awareness and legal requirements. 2. **Disability Rights Advocate**: These advocates work to promote the rights and interests of people with disabilities, often in policy-making and legal contexts. Their role is crucial in driving social change and promoting equal opportunities. 3. **Feminist Disability Studies Scholar**: Scholars in this field conduct research and teach about the intersections of disability, gender, and sexuality. Their work contributes to a better understanding of systemic oppression and informs social justice initiatives. 4. **Disability Inclusion Consultant**: These consultants help organizations create inclusive environments for employees with disabilities. Their expertise is in demand as more companies prioritize diversity and inclusion. 5. **Healthcare Professional (Disability Focused)**: Healthcare professionals specializing in disability care provide medical and therapeutic services to individuals with disabilities. This role is essential for improving the quality of life for many people and requires specialized knowledge and skills. With a Masterclass Certificate in Feminist Disability Studies, students can pursue rewarding careers that contribute to social change and promote equal opportunities for all.
